Goodreads asked Scott D Carlson:

What books are on your summer reading list this year?

Scott D Carlson I read Italo Svevo's "Zeno's Conscience," which is not an easy read but a rewarding one. It's a little-known gem by a little-known writer who lived in Trieste, Italy. He knew James Joyce, and Joyce like the book. I also read a novel by another "italo," Italo Calvino--If On a Winter's Night a Traveler. Calvino loved to explore with form, and "Winter's Night" is wildly that.
